In a call to action, "Tu Voz, My Venture" awarded 50 winning teams with start-up grants of up to $1,000 to launch their ventures to help young Latinos stay in school and prepare for college and beyond. Five finalist teams were selected to receive a $5,000 scholarship. This initiative was launched in partnership with Youth Venture,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ation and MTV Tr3s Voces. The five grand-prize "Tu Voz, My Venture" teams: Bio Motors: Veggies give you GAS, Los Angeles, CA: The team's action plan assists Latino students with transportation to educational programs, while engaging them in a movement to expand awareness of the use of environmentally conscious fuel. The plan calls for converting an old school bus diesel engine to run on used vegetable oil collected from fast food restaurants. College Bound Latinos, Arlington, VA: This team plans to host trips to colleges for young Latinos to expose them to college life and reinforce the importance of a college education The program informs students about scholarship opportunities and also plans on educating the parents by hosting "college night sessions" in English and Spanish. SOUL, Gresham, OR: Concerned about high dropout and pregnancy rates among young Latinas, the ultimate goal of this venture is to get Latina students in Gresham High School focused on school and college through mentoring, homework tutoring, and the building of self-esteem and stronger social networks. Latino Youth for Community Preparedness (LYCP) Oakland, CA: This team will provide Bi-lingual first aid and disaster preparedness presentations and trainings to raise awareness and educate the Hispanic community in ways that they can protect themselves and loved ones in the event of a natural disaster or in an emergency situation. This Venture wants to help people realize they can do something to protect themselves and save other people lives when it comes to natural disasters and medical emergencies and education. Peques Chavos Fundacion de Futbol (FF) Southampton, NY: This Venture seeks to motivate Latino youth to stay in school and continue their studies through their desire to be part of a group that supports the playing of soccer. The goal is to create an opportunity to use a popular sport like soccer to inspire youth to strive for scholarships and further their higher education possibilities.
